Reliable
I recently received my dad's Honda Accord, and it was quite the upgrade from my Saturn Ion. The gas mileage is better, it has more features, and is just generally a nicer car. I love driving whether it's a short drive to work or a longer drive on the interstate. I know that I'll be able to drive this for quite some time thanks to its low mileage on the odometer. I could easily get close to 8 more years out of it. Being a college student, that is extremely helpful since my financial situation is lacking.

Meh
This is my first car. I was so excited about it at first, but there have been so many issues; the hood paint came off, the brakes and the alignment are always off, and it is too low to the ground. With everything comes some good; it gets great gas mileage, I can fill up my tank for 20 dollars, it is very comfortable inside and the air works amazingly. I think that this is an ok first car, but I would not recommend it to anyone. I was impressed to the fact that I made it all the way from Georgia to Florida with only stopping for gas twice. I think that was amazing. The mileage is in the 100000's but it has been driven a good bit. I got it after my graduation from high school. There is ample trunk space but the back seat is often too small. With the car being so low to the ground it is hard to be able to have many people in the car. I think this is why there have been so many mechanical issues because there are speed bumps everywhere that I live. I recently looked into getting canoe racks put on top of my car.
